Y. and Geethanjali R. and Khamer Ferzana Banu.}, title = {Estimation of Chlorophyll Content of Mung Bean Plants Treated with Amaranthus viridis }, journal = {International Journal of Innovative Research in Technology}, year = {}, volume = {9}, number = {8}, pages = {262-264}, issn = {2349-6002}, url = {https://ijirt.org/article?manuscript=157916}, abstract = {The current research investigation was carried out with the main aim of extraction of photosynthetic pigments (chlorophyll-a and chlorophyll-b) by using acetone solvent. The study is also concern on the extraction ratio of biomolecules with respect to different concentrations. Chlorophyll a, and Chlorophyll b were extracted from the test samples of mung beans plants treated with Amaranthus viridis (AV) extracts of different concentrations viz. AV 100%, AV 80%, AV 60%, AV 40%, AV 20%, and 0% as control using 100% acetone. Results delineated that different trend was observed in extraction rate for chlorophylls. Highest content of chlorophylls (Ch-a & Ch-b) was noted in test sample AV 80% (mung bean plants treated with 80% concentrated Amaranthus viridis extract). Whereas, lowest content of chlorophylls (Ch-a & Ch-b) was present in AV 60% (AV 60% = mung bean plants treated with 60% concentrated extract of Amaranthus viridis) & 0% (0% = untreated mung bean plants) respectively. }, keywords = {Chlorophyl-a, Chlorophyll-b, Amaranthus viridis, Solvent extraction, Vigna radiata}, month = {}, }
